Related: Editorials & Other Articles, Issue Forums, Alliance Forums, Region ForumsHere's What Families Are Actually Using the Child Tax Credit to Pay For
Overwhelmingly, people who have received the child tax credit payments have used it for food, rent, and utilities and to pay off debt, data from the U.S. Census Bureau has found.
